Monthly Cost of Living
😐A single person spends $670 per month in Kharkiv vs $607 in Sfax,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$1,073 per month in Kharkiv vs $984 in Sfax,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$1,476 per month in Kharkiv vs $1,360 in Sfax, rent included.
😐Kharkiv costs about 10% more than Sfax,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Both Kharkiv and Sfax are more affordable than the global median – Kharkiv50% lower, Sfax55% lower.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$183 in Kharkiv versus $187 in Sfax.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 63% higher in Kharkiv,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$27.00 in Kharkiv versus $20.00 in Sfax. Groceries tell a different story – $153 in Kharkiv vs $188 in Sfax – so Kharkiv wins on supermarket bills even if dining out costs more.
